Output 873839b1d4a04292632759ef4b8737065f592d7416c973679ac1311d60a82a27:23

value
352738
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08e08df4860ff277763523bd0128334ce4fd9504 OP_EQUAL
address
32VxLQ7z85rZ3QSi4RTCoNYuRMJUZP7gQW
transaction
873839b1d4a04292632759ef4b8737065f592d7416c973679ac1311d60a82a27
spent
true